The only things to be aware of is 1- you can't control how close you are to the park, my experience has been that you usually end up with one of the convention center hotels. You just have to take the shuttle. 2- the hotel may have a resort fee, which is in addition to the nightly rate, and can be up to $15/night (I ran into that once on hotwire for the crowne plaza, it was still a great deal). 3- if you are driving, parking will be extra which can be quite a bit.
If none of these are an issue I would probably take a crack at priceline for less and if that fails book on hotwire. Either way it should be a nice hotel at a good price!
